function timeAgo pDate
local tNow, tDiff, tDay
-- convert the internet date to seconds
convert pDate to seconds
put pDate into tDay
-- make sure it is a valid date/timestamp
if the result is not empty then
return pDate
end if
-- figure out what day it is now
put the date into tNow
convert tNow to seconds
-- special case, check for "Today" when there is no time specified
if tNow - pDate is zero then
return "Today"
end if
-- extract just the date and convert it back
convert tDay to date
convert tDay to seconds
if tDay < tNow then
put (tNow - tDay) div (24 * 60 * 60) into tDiff
-- duration could be on the order of days, weeks, months, or years
if tDiff < 2 then
return "Yesterday"
else if tDiff < 7 then
return tDiff && "days ago"
else if tDiff < 14 then
return "1 week ago"
else if tDiff < 28 then
return (tDiff div 7) && "weeks ago"
else if tDiff < 56 then
return "1 month ago"
else if tDiff < 365 then
return (tDiff div 30) && "months ago"
else if tDiff < 730 then
return "1 year ago"
end if
-- a very long time ago, in a galaxy far away ;-)
return (tDiff div 365) && "years ago"
end if
-- get the number of seconds that have elapsed instead
put the seconds into tNow
put tNow - pDate into tDiff
-- duration could be seconds, minutes, or hours
if tDiff < 60 then
return "less than 1 minute ago"
else if tDiff < 120 then
return "1 minute ago"
else if tDiff < 60 * 60 then
return (tDiff div 60) && "minutes ago"
else if tDiff < 120 * 60 then
return "1 hour ago"
end if
-- several hours ago
return (tDiff div 3600) && "hours ago"
end timeAgo
